.mp-input{width:420px;position:relative}.mp-input--error input{border-color:#b11f26 !important}.mp-input--error .mp-input-message{display:inline-block !important;font-size:14px;line-height:24px;color:#b11f26;margin-top:4px}.mp-input .mp-input-message{display:none}.mp-input-history{position:absolute;left:12px;top:calc(100% + 8px);z-index:2;width:320px;background:#fff;padding:8px 0;filter:drop-shadow(0px 0px 8px rgba(0, 0, 0, 0.12))}.mp-input-history::before{font-size:0;position:absolute;width:0;height:0;content:"";border:6px dashed rgba(0,0,0,0);bottom:100%;left:inherit;right:inherit;margin-bottom:-1px;border-bottom-style:solid;margin-left:26px;border-bottom-color:#fff}.mp-input-history-item{font-size:14px;line-height:24px;padding:4px 20px;color:#666;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:1;-webkit-box-orient:vertical}.mp-input-history-item:hover{cursor:pointer;background:rgba(0,0,0,.04)}.mp-input-history-item+.mp-input-history-item{margin-top:8px}.mp-input::after{font-size:0;position:absolute;width:0;height:0;content:"";border:5px dashed rgba(0,0,0,0);bottom:100%;left:inherit;right:inherit;border-bottom-style:solid;margin-left:25px;border-bottom-color:#fff}.mp-input input{width:100%;padding:4px 12px;font-size:14px;line-height:24px;background:#fff;border:1px solid #dcdcdc;transition:border-color .25s}.mp-input input:focus{border-color:#0052d9}.mp-input input::placeholder{color:#ccc}.mp-textarea{width:420px}.mp-textarea textarea{width:calc(100% - 26px);padding:4px 12px;font-size:14px;line-height:24px;background:#fff;border:1px solid #dcdcdc;transition:border-color .25s;resize:none}.mp-textarea textarea:focus{border-color:#0052d9;outline:none}.mp-textarea textarea::placeholder{color:#ccc}.tea-overlay{z-index:9}.mp-qr-code{position:relative;overflow:hidden;background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-qrCode-bgaaaa9c1516fc408f827d.svg) no-repeat;background-size:cover;padding:16px}.mp-qr-code__code{margin:8px 32px 0px 28px}.mp-qr-code__code-img{width:100%;height:100%}.mp-qr-code__title{text-align:center;color:#000;font-size:14px;font-style:normal;font-weight:400;line-height:24px;padding-top:8px}.mp-dialog{background-color:#fff;padding:40px;max-height:calc(100% - 240px);height:auto;position:relative}.mp-dialog::-webkit-scrollbar{height:0;width:0}.mp-dialog-hd{margin-bottom:20px}.mp-dialog-hd .mp-icon--close{position:absolute;right:20px;top:20px;cursor:pointer}.mp-dialog-title{font-family:"PingFang SC";font-style:normal;font-weight:500;font-size:20px;line-height:32px}.mp-form-item{display:table-row}.mp-form-item:last-child .mp-form__controls{padding-bottom:0}.mp-form__label{display:table-cell;font-size:14px;line-height:24px;color:#666;padding-right:24px;vertical-align:baseline;width:1px}.mp-form__label label{display:inline-block;white-space:nowrap;font-size:14px;-webkit-transform:translateZ(0);transform:translateZ(0)}.mp-form__controls{display:table-cell;vertical-align:top;padding-bottom:20px;color:#000;word-wrap:break-word;word-break:break-word;width:100%}@media screen and (max-width: 768px){.mp-form__label{padding-right:14px}.mp-form__controls{padding-bottom:16px}}.mp-customer-service{position:relative;display:flex;flex-direction:column;align-items:center}.mp-customer-service__online{display:flex;flex-direction:column;width:50px;height:86px;justify-content:center;align-items:center;cursor:pointer;background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-customerService-bg9c09d5dbbfd47c9edfc9.svg) no-repeat;background-size:100% 100%}.mp-customer-service__online-service{width:30px;height:30px;background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-customerService-service1924e871c18f73c96b28.svg) no-repeat;background-size:100% 100%}.mp-customer-service__online-tit{color:#fff;text-align:center;font-size:12px;font-weight:500;line-height:16px;width:60%}.mp-customer-service__online:hover{background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-customerService-bg-active9d16ccb2504fdfee7905.svg) no-repeat;background-size:100% 100%}.mp-customer-service__edit{width:50px;height:50px;margin-top:12px;background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-customerService-edit6e652304134fdd1d2846.png) no-repeat;background-size:100% 100%;display:flex;align-items:center;justify-content:center;border-radius:50%;cursor:pointer}.mp-customer-service__edit:hover{background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-customerService-edit-activebced91f686ce75bbb8fb.png) no-repeat;background-size:100% 100%;box-shadow:0 8px 20px rgba(65,98,165,.1)}.mp-customer-service__back{margin-top:12px;width:50px;height:50px;background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-customerService-backccad2130fcc21f161bef.png) no-repeat;background-size:100% 100%;border-radius:50%;cursor:pointer}.mp-customer-service__back:hover{box-shadow:0 8px 20px rgba(65,98,165,.1);background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-customerService-back-active52cc87b8f5990bc44935.png) no-repeat;background-size:100% 100%}.mp-infoDialog-dialog{width:640px;padding:0 40px !important;overflow-y:scroll;overflow-y:overlay;overflow-x:hidden;max-height:calc(100% - 80px)}.mp-infoDialog-dialog .mp-dialog-hd{position:sticky;top:0;padding:40px 0 20px;width:100%;background:#fff;z-index:1000;margin-bottom:0px}.mp-infoDialog-dialog .mp-dialog-hd .mp-icon--close{position:absolute;top:20px;right:-20px}.mp-infoDialog-dialog-notice{background:rgba(0,82,217,.08);border:1px solid #0052d9;font-size:14px;line-height:24px;color:rgba(0,0,0,.65);padding:12px 20px;margin-bottom:20px}.mp-infoDialog-dialog-block .mp-form__label label{min-width:56px}.mp-infoDialog-dialog-block .mp-form__label label::after{content:"*";color:#e54545;font-size:14px;font-style:normal;font-weight:400;line-height:24px}.mp-infoDialog-dialog-block .mp-input,.mp-infoDialog-dialog-block .mp-textarea{width:100%}.mp-infoDialog-dialog-block--title{font-family:"PingFang SC";font-style:normal;font-weight:500;font-size:16px;line-height:26px;color:#000}.mp-infoDialog-dialog-block .mp-form{margin-top:12px}.mp-infoDialog-dialog-block .mp-form .mp-form-item:nth-child(4) .mp-form__label label::after{content:""}.mp-infoDialog-dialog-block .mp-form .mp-form__label{line-height:34px}.mp-infoDialog-dialog-block .mp-form .mp-textarea textarea{line-height:25px}.mp-infoDialog-dialog-block--desc{font-size:14px;line-height:24px;color:hsla(0,0%,40%,.65);margin-top:8px}.mp-infoDialog-dialog-check .mp-checkbox{width:14px;flex:0 0 14px;transform:translate(0, 3px)}.mp-infoDialog-dialog-check .check-link-input{display:inline-block;font-size:14px;line-height:20px;color:#454545;margin-left:9px}.mp-infoDialog-dialog-check .check-link-input .form__anchor-link{color:#0052d9}.mp-infoDialog-dialog-check .check-link{display:flex}.mp-infoDialog-dialog-check .check-error-text{margin-top:4px;font-size:14px;line-height:24px;color:#b11f26}.mp-infoDialog-dialog-footer{position:sticky;bottom:0;background:#fff;width:100%;z-index:1000;padding:40px 0;display:flex;align-items:center}.mp-infoDialog-dialog-footer .mp-btn--blue{width:100%}.mp-infoDialog-dialog-footer .mp-btn{width:100%}.mp-infoDialog-dialog-footer .mp-btn .mp-icon{animation:spin .6s linear infinite;vertical-align:middle}@keyframes spin{0%{-webkit-transform:rotate(0deg);transform:rotate(0deg)}100%{-webkit-transform:rotate(359deg);transform:rotate(359deg)}}.mp-infoDialog-dialog .mp-dialog-bd .mp-form-item .tea-form-check-group{padding:7px 0 10px;display:flex;align-items:center}.mp-infoDialog-dialog .mp-dialog-bd .mp-form-item .tea-form-check-group .tea-form-check{display:flex;align-items:center}.mp-infoDialog-dialog .mp-dialog-bd .mp-form-item .tea-form-check-group .tea-form-check__label{color:#000;font-size:14px;font-style:normal;font-weight:400}.mp-infoDialog-dialog .mp-dialog-bd .mp-form-item .tea-form-check-group .tea-form-check+.tea-form-check{margin-left:15px}@media screen and (max-width: 768px){.mp-dialog{background-color:#fff;margin:0 16px;padding:20px !important;max-height:calc(100% - 72px)}.mp-dialog-title{font-size:16px;line-height:22.5px}.mp-infoDialog-dialog .mp-dialog-hd{padding:0 0 20px}.mp-infoDialog-dialog .mp-dialog-hd .mp-icon--close{top:0;right:0}.mp-infoDialog-dialog-footer{padding-bottom:0}}.mp-legacy-problem{position:relative;overflow:hidden;width:172px;height:80px;background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-legacyProblem-bg9cb71cd59653194ee8c7.svg) no-repeat;background-size:100% 100%}.mp-legacy-problem:hover{cursor:pointer}.mp-legacy-problem:hover .mp-legacy-problem__head-title{text-decoration:underline}.mp-legacy-problem__head{margin:15px 0 0 15px;display:flex;align-items:center}.mp-legacy-problem__head-icon{width:16px;height:16px;background:url(https://market-isv-1258344699.file.myqcloud.com/market-node/prod/images/20230814-legacyProblem-editabb4eea55ee4594a47c8.svg) no-repeat;background-size:100% 100%}.mp-legacy-problem__head-title{color:#000;font-size:14px;font-style:normal;font-weight:500;line-height:24px;margin-left:8px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.mp-legacy-problem__description{color:#9da8bb;font-size:12px;font-style:normal;font-weight:400;line-height:17px;margin:5px 12px 0 39px;word-break:break-all;text-overflow:ellipsis;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2;overflow:hidden}.mp-form{display:table}
